Georgia Recorder is looking for writers

Georgia recorder is looking for writers to help our team during the 2022 legislative session—not necessarily covering the Legislature. Assignments could range from K-12 mask rules to COVID trends.

ABOUT THE COMPANY

The Georgia Recorder is an independent, nonprofit news organization that is focused on connecting public policies to stories of the people and communities affected by them. We bring a fresh perspective to coverage of the state’s biggest issues. We’ll provide you with a steady mix of in-depth stories, blog posts and social media updates on the latest news and progressive commentary.

WHAT TO INCLUDE IN SUBMISSION

  • The cover letter should explain why you are the best candidate to cover/write about the legislative sessions, K-12 mask rules, COVID-19 trends, etc.
  • A summary of your relevant experience, credentials and publication credits
  • Include your strongest clips or links to published work
  • Attach a resume detailing your writing experience.

COMPENSATION

  •  $250+ per article. It is recommended that you discuss/negotiate the rate individually with the editor.
